SSL证书可以多域名通配符吗

发布日期: 2024-12-21

本文探讨了SSL证书是否支持多域名通配符,以及这种证书的工作原理和使用场景。


SSL证书可以多域名通配符吗

本文总体约600字,阅读需要大概2分钟 随着互联网技术的发展,SSL证书已成为网站安全的重要组成部分。SSL证书,也称为TLS证书,用于在用户浏览器和服务器之间建立加密连接,保护数据传输的安全。在多域名管理的场景中,SSL证书的通配符功能显得尤为重要。本文将详细解释SSL证书是否可以支持多域名通配符,以及其背后的技术原理和实际应用。 首先,我们需要了解什么是通配符SSL证书。通配符SSL证书是一种可以保护一个主域名及其所有子域名的SSL证书。例如,如果你拥有一个名为example.com的主域名,通配符证书可以同时保护example.com和其所有子域名,如mail.example.com、shop.example.com等。这种类型的证书极大地简化了管理多个子域名SSL证书的过程。 在技术层面上,通配符SSL证书通过在证书的CN(Common Name)字段中使用星号(*)来实现。这个星号代表任何字符序列,因此可以匹配任何子域名。然而,需要注意的是,通配符仅适用于子域名,不适用于顶级域名或二级域名。例如,*.example.com可以匹配mail.example.com,但不能匹配example.com或com。 对于是否可以使用多域名通配符SSL证书,答案是可以的。市场上存在一些证书颁发机构(CA)提供的SSL证书产品,它们支持在一个证书中包含多个通配符条目。这意味着你可以在一个证书中保护多个主域名及其所有子域名。例如,你可以拥有一个证书来保护*.example.com、*.test.com和*.dev.com等。这种类型的证书特别适合拥有多个品牌的企业或需要管理大量子域名的组织。 使用多域名通配符SSL证书的好处包括: 1. **简化管理**:一个证书管理多个域名,减少了证书管理的复杂性。 2. **成本效益**:相比于为每个域名购买单独的证书,多域名通配符证书通常更具成本效益。 3. **安全性**:确保所有子域名都受到SSL加密保护,增强了整体的网络安全性。 然而,使用多域名通配符SSL证书也有一些限制和注意事项: 1. **兼容性**:并非所有的浏览器和服务器都支持多域名通配符证书。在部署前需要确保兼容性。 2. **证书透明度**:一些CA要求在证书透明度日志中记录所有包含的域名,这可能会增加管理负担。 3. **证书更新**:如果需要添加或移除域名,可能需要重新颁发证书,这可能会带来额外的工作和成本。 总之,多域名通配符SSL证书是一种有效的解决方案,用于保护多个域名及其子域名的安全。在选择和部署这类证书时,了解其工作原理和限制是非常重要的。随着网络安全需求的不断增长,多域名通配符SSL证书将继续在网站安全领域扮演重要角色。 感谢您阅读完本文,请对我们的内容予以点评,以帮助我们提升